The Heavy Equipment Specialist I is responsible for performing skilled operations of several types of heavy equipment used to excavate, load, transfer or move dirt, gravel or materials in the maintenance and repair of streets, sidewalks, driveways, alleys, drainage and asphalt as well as brush removal.

Work involves responsibility for efficient use of such equipment. Duties include performance of manual labor associated with street maintenance and construction.

Duties

Operates equipment such as street sweeper, dump truck, compactor, picker truck, backhoe, concrete breaker and loader as well as assorted hand and pneumatic tools.

Operates all necessary equipment in construction and maintenance of drainage and streets.

Inspects, cleans and performs routine maintenance work on vehicles and equipment daily; identifies and reports mechanical problems and damage.

Performs traffic control activities as needed; reports safety hazards and traffic problems. Utilizes proper safety precautions in all work performed;

recognizes, avoids and reports unsafe acts, conditions, accidents and injuries.

Performs skilled and semiskilled construction, maintenance and general labor work in the maintenance and repair of streets, sidewalks, driveways, alleys, drainage and asphalt repairs.

Performs all other related duties as assigned.

About City of Baytown, TX

The City of Baytown provides municipal government services to the residents, businesses, and guests of the Baytown Community. The city now known as Baytown was originally three separate towns. The first of these was Goose Creek, named for the bayou of the same name where Canada geese wintered and whose name is still reflected in the area's Goose Creek CISD, whose establishment dates back to before 1850. With the discovery of the Goose Creek Oil Field, the neighboring communities of Pelly in the late 1910s, and East Baytown in the early 1920s, developed as early boomtowns. Serious talk of mergi...ng the three cities began shortly after World War I, but the community of Baytown was opposed to this idea. However, in 1947, the three cities finally agreed to consolidate. The citizens settled on the name Baytown for the new combined city. Baytown as it is known today was officially founded January 24, 1948. More
